Sea Colony Beach Patrol returns with another first place win during the largest all-women lifeguard

  • Aug 1, 2019
  • 1 min read

267 women, representing 25 beach patrols, competed in the 34th Annual All-Women's Lifeguard Challenge in Sandy Hook, New Jersey on July 31st. The challenge is the longest running all-women lifeguard event in the nation. When it was all over, Sea Colony emerged with another Division I First Place title and 142 points. Second place Division I was held by Lavallette with 82 points.
